diff options
author | Qu Wenruo <quwenruo@cn.fujitsu.com> | 2014-07-03 17:36:38 +0800 |
---|---|---|
committer | David Sterba <dsterba@suse.cz> | 2014-10-10 09:09:47 +0200 |
commit | a1a3dc7fd4fb7ab0abb1269d030d85e385fc8038 (patch) | |
tree | b28077c47b449257cd58aa41455b71ee042c10bc /btrfs-corrupt-block.c | |
parent | 5a7157e1a6da26c6058ddb889937fcb4f66edee9 (diff) |
btrfs-progs: Fix malloc size for superblock.
recover_prepare() in chunk-recover.c alloc memory which only contains
sizeof(struct btrfs_super_block). This will cause glibc malloc error
after superblock csum is calculated.
Use BTRFS_SUPER_INFO_SIZE to fix the bug.
Signed-off-by: Qu Wenruo <quwenruo@cn.fujitsu.com>
Signed-off-by: David Sterba <dsterba@suse.cz>
Diffstat (limited to 'btrfs-corrupt-block.c')
0 files changed, 0 insertions, 0 deletions